Earlier this month, we reported that FOX cancelled Making History after only one season. Recently, creator Julius Sharpe reacted to the news on Twitter.
The sitcom follows three friends from two different centuries, as they try to balance the fun and adventure of time travel with the humdrum responsibilities of their otherwise ordinary lives. The cast includes Adam Pally, Yassir Lester, Leighton Meester, John Gemberling, and Neil Casey.
On Twitter, Sharpe thanked the cast and crew of Making History in addition to making some jokes about the show’s cancellation:
